84.51° Overview
84.51° is a retail data science, insights and media company. We help The Kroger Co., consumer packaged goods companies, agencies, publishers and affiliates create more personalized and valuable experiences for shoppers across the path to purchase. Powered by cutting-edge science, we utilize first-party retail data from more than 62 million U.S. households sourced through the Kroger Plus loyalty card program to fuel a more customer-centric journey using 84.51° Insights, 84.51° Loyalty Marketing and our retail media advertising solution, Kroger Precision Marketing. 84.51° follows a 5-day in-office work schedule to support collaboration, alignment, and team connection. Senior Data Scientist Consultant, SPI – Agent Platform Team
Summary
The Agent Platform Team, within AI Enablement at 84.51°, owns and manages the core platforms that power data science and AI across the organization. This role sits on the SPI (Science Platform Innovation) squad and is focused specifically on the Databricks environment and its evolving AI/ML capabilities. You will be the bridge between the engineers building and maintaining our Databricks platform and the data scientists who use it every day. You are not building models for end-clients. Instead, you ensure the platform behaves as expected for the people on it—that new capabilities are tested, documented, and adopted smoothly, and that practitioner pain points make it back to the platform team in a way that shapes the roadmap. You’ll build deep familiarity with Databricks’ infrastructure and AI powered capabilities—including Genie Code, Genie spaces, Agent Bricks, MLflow, and other features as they emerge—as well as the Unity Catalog governance layer that underpins them. You’ll test and evaluate new Databricks features and relevant third-party integrations from the perspective of an end-user, document your findings, and help the team decide what to adopt, how to roll it out, and what to skip. This is a small, highly collaborative squad. Everyone pitches in on a bit of everything. Priorities shift frequently as the Databricks roadmap evolves. Success in this role is less about fixed technical expertise and more about comfort with ambiguity, good judgment about where to spend your time, and the ability to influence without direct authority.
Responsibilities
- Voice of the practitioner: Serve as the primary liaison between data scientists using Databricks and the platform engineering team. Gather requirements, surface pain points, and translate practitioner needs into actionable feedback that shapes platform decisions and roadmaps.
- Technology evaluation: Lead the testing and evaluation of new Databricks capabilities (e.g., Mosaic AI features, Model Serving enhancements, Genie, new Unity Catalog functionality) and relevant third-party tools. Document findings, recommended use cases, limitations, and rollout considerations. Over time, this may evolve from hands-on beta testing toward designing and coordinating evaluation efforts across groups of practitioners.
- Onboarding & enablement: Write guides, maintain documentation, lead training sessions, and run office hours to help data scientists adopt new platform capabilities. Partner with Learning & Development where appropriate. Serve as a first line of support when teams hit roadblocks.
- Adoption & communication: Evangelize Databricks capabilities to increase awareness and drive adoption. Produce clear release notes, communications, and materials for both technical and non-technical audiences.
- Cross-functional collaboration: Work closely with the solution architect, cloud engineer, and product senior on the squad to ensure proposed technologies have well-defined use cases and that guidelines and best practices are established. Act as a data science ambassador to cross-functional teams, explaining recommended workflows and the reasoning behind platform choices.
- Governance & compliance support: Help validate that new platform capabilities meet enterprise requirements around security, compliance, observability, and data governance (e.g., Unity Catalog lineage, Azure connectivity).

What Ohio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in senior learning consultant jobs across Ohio.
- Bachelor's degree in instructional design, education, organizational development, or a related field
- Proficiency with authoring tools such as Articulate Storyline, Rise, or Adobe Captivate
- Experience conducting needs assessments and translating performance gaps into learning solutions
- Familiarity with learning management systems including Cornerstone, Workday Learning, or similar platforms
- Strong project management skills with the ability to handle multiple concurrent program designs
- Certification such as CPTD or ATD credentials preferred by many enterprise employers
